Understanding Nonprofits
Next up, let's chat about nonprofits. These organizations are the backbone of many communities, working tirelessly to address social, environmental, and economic issues. Unlike for-profit businesses, nonprofits are not driven by the goal of making money for shareholders. Instead, they focus on fulfilling a specific mission, such as providing education, healthcare, or disaster relief. They reinvest any surplus revenue back into their programs and services, rather than distributing it as profits.
Nonprofits come in all shapes and sizes, ranging from small community-based organizations to large international charities. They operate in a wide variety of sectors, including education, healthcare, arts and culture, environmental conservation, and social services. Some nonprofits focus on providing direct services to individuals in need, while others work to advocate for policy changes or raise awareness about important issues. Regardless of their size or focus, all nonprofits share a common goal: to make a positive impact on the world.
One of the key characteristics of nonprofits is their reliance on donations and grants from individuals, foundations, corporations, and government agencies. These funds are used to support the organization's programs and services, as well as its administrative and fundraising costs. Nonprofits are typically governed by a board of directors or trustees, who are responsible for ensuring that the organization operates in accordance with its mission and values. The board provides oversight and guidance to the organization's executive director or CEO, who is responsible for the day-to-day management of the organization.

ProPublica: Journalism in the Public Interest
Now, let's shine a spotlight on ProPublica. This is an independent, non-profit newsroom that produces investigative journalism in the public interest. What does that mean? Well, ProPublica reporters dig deep into important issues, holding power accountable and exposing wrongdoing. They don't shy away from tough topics and their work often leads to real-world change.
ProPublica was founded in 2007 with the mission of producing journalism that has the potential to drive change. They focus on investigative reporting, which involves in-depth, long-term investigations that uncover hidden truths and expose systemic problems. ProPublica reporters spend months, or even years, researching and reporting on a single story, meticulously gathering evidence and interviewing sources to build a compelling case. Their work covers a wide range of topics, including government corruption, corporate misconduct, environmental issues, and social injustice.
One of the things that sets ProPublica apart from other news organizations is its commitment to non-partisanship. They don't take sides and they don't shy away from criticizing both Democrats and Republicans. Their only allegiance is to the truth and to the public interest. This commitment to independence and objectivity has earned ProPublica a reputation for credibility and trustworthiness.
